简介
nodox-editor-plugin 是一个基于 Node.js 平台的 markdown 编辑器插件,它提供了丰富的编辑器功能和扩展能力,使得用户能够更加方便快捷地编辑 markdown 文档。本文将介绍 nodox-editor-plugin 的使用教程,帮助前端开发者深入了解该插件。
安装
在使用 nodox-editor-plugin 之前,需要先进行安装。可以通过以下命令在 npm 上进行安装:
npm install nodox-editor-plugin --save
安装完成后,就可以在任何模块中通过 require() 来引用 nodox-editor-plugin。
使用
初始化
首先,需要引入 nodox-editor-plugin,并调用其构造函数进行初始化:
var NodoxEditorPlugin = require('nodox-editor-plugin'); var editor = new NodoxEditorPlugin();
绑定 DOM
接下来,需要将编辑器插件绑定到一个 HTML 元素上:
<div id="editor"></div>
editor.bind('#editor');
这样,就可以在页面上显示编辑器插件。
导入和导出
nodox-editor-plugin 可以支持 markdown 文档的导入和导出。下面是一个示例代码,展示了如何将 markdown 文档导入到编辑器中,并将编辑器中的文档导出为 HTML 格式:
var markdown = '这里是 markdown 文档的内容'; editor.fromMarkdown(markdown); var html = editor.toHtml(); console.log(html);
插件扩展
nodox-editor-plugin 支持插件扩展,用户可以根据自己的需求编写插件,并通过注册到编辑器中来扩展编辑器的功能。以下是一个简单的示例代码,展示了如何注册一个插件:
var MyPlugin = require('my-plugin'); var plugin = new MyPlugin(); editor.use(plugin);
这样,MyPlugin 对象的所有方法和属性就会被注册到编辑器中,从而扩展了编辑器的功能。
总结
本文介绍了 nodox-editor-plugin 的基本使用方法,从安装开始,一直到导入和导出、插件扩展等操作。通过使用 nodox-editor-plugin,前端开发者可以更加方便和快捷地进行 markdown 文档的编写和管理。如果您有兴趣,可以去 npm 官网查看 nodox-editor-plugin 的详情,并了解更多的使用方法和技巧。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005601381e8991b448de14a